1. Corrie ten Boom: The Power of Forgiveness

Born in the Netherlands, Corrie and her family hid Jewish people during the Nazi occupation. Even after losing her sister and father in a concentration camp, Corrie spent the rest of her life traveling the globe to preach about a God who forgives. Her story reminds us that no hole is so deep that God’s love is not deeper still.

2. Harriet Tubman: Guided by the Spirit

Known as the "Moses of her people," Harriet relied on her deep Methodist faith to lead enslaved people to freedom. Though she couldn't read, she memorized Scripture and claimed that God spoke to her through "vibrations" and dreams to guide her paths. She is a testament to perseverance and divine protection.

3. Louis Zamperini: From POW to Preacher

After surviving 47 days at sea and years of torture in a Japanese POW camp, Louis was consumed by hate. However, after attending a Billy Graham revival, he gave his life to Christ. He eventually returned to Japan to personally forgive his former captors, proving that Christ can heal even the most broken heart.

4. William Seymour: The Fire of Azusa Street

A son of former slaves, Seymour led the Azusa Street Revival in 1906. This movement is a cornerstone of our heritage, showing how the Holy Spirit can break down racial and social barriers. It reminds us that God uses the humble to spark global change.

5. Casey Diaz: The Shotcaller’s Choice

Once a high-ranking gang leader in Los Angeles, Casey committed a murder at age 16 and ended up in solitary confinement. A mundane interaction with a Christian volunteer led to a miraculous encounter with Jesus in his cell. Today, he is a pastor, showing that no one is beyond the reach of grace.

10. Joni Eareckson Tada: Strength in Weakness

After a diving accident left her quadriplegic at 17, Joni struggled with God’s plan. Decades later, she has become a global advocate for the disabled, showing that God’s power is made perfect in our weakness.

11. Nicky Cruz: Run Baby Run

A former leader of the Mau Maus gang in New York, Nicky’s life was changed when preacher David Wilkerson told him "Jesus loves you" despite Nicky’s threats. This story is a beautiful piece of our history, highlighting how one bold act of digital or physical outreach can change a generation.
